Find answers to your general questions and get help registering at the Welcome Center. It's open Monday-Thursday, 8 a.m.-7 p.m. & Friday, 8 a.m.-1 p.m. (except on holidays).
Parking permits are NOW required for the Fall semester. The two-week Fall parking grace period for student parking stalls ended on September 14, 2025. Buy your $20 Fall Parking Permit online and pick up in the Business Office, or buy in-person at the Business Office for $20. Daily parking permits are also available from a parking pay station for $2 (cash only; selected pay stations accept cash and credit card).
Paying your $10 ASO fee unlocks valuable campus resources and opportunities! With your fee, you gain access to a counselor, free food at ASO events, the ability to join or charter clubs, run for student government, apply for scholarships, attend field trips, and more. Invest in your college experience today! For more info, email @email or call (818) 778-5516.
Ride Metro buses and trains at NO COST! All students enrolled in LAVC Fall classes are eligible to get a FREE Metro GoPass. However, you will need to pick up a Metro GoPass Card and use the 2025-2026 activation code on or before September 30, 2025! Stop by the Welcome Center or Business Office to pick up your free GoPass TAP Card.
